Hello! I have bought one more hard drive, so, instead of my oldest hard drive, I put it into my computer case. My oldest hard drive is Maxtor 20 GB hard drive. So, I am wondering if there is any possibility to make external hard drive of this internal hard drive and if it is, please, tell me what I need to do.

Hello! All you need to do is to buy external enclosure. I mean, all hard drives are same, just one of them are placed in computer cases and other ones in external enclosures. When you put it there, just connect it to your computer. So, you will be able to store some files, folders and other data on it…
